Truth for Teenagers

September 22, 2013 by Stephen and Ginger Jordan

Stephen teaching the girls
Stephen teaching the girls

Over the years, we have noticed the trend of the teenagers has been to grow up in the village, go to college, and move away from the village.  Many of them are leaving, without having listened to God’s Word being taught.  Also, as our children get older, we see the need for them to have more of a part in the ministry, and to develop better relationships with kids their age.  With this in mind, we have begun a chronological Bible study for teenage girls in our home.

Girls searching for answers from God's Word
Girls searching for answers from God's Word

Since knowledge of the English language is helpful and even necessary for these girls to do well in both high school and college, we are also teaching some English during the Bible study, using God’s Word as the textbook.  This way, our girls are learning more of the Agutaynen language, the girls in the village are learning more English, all are getting good Bible teaching both in English and Agutaynen, and all the girls are building better friendships.  We are excited for this new avenue of teaching God’s Word to the Agutaynen teenage girls in our village.

Volleyball after the Bible study
Volleyball after the Bible study

There has been an average of 15 girls meeting in our living room on Saturday mornings, along with our two girls and our partner’s daughter.  Please pray for wisdom in how best to incorporate some English into the lessons, and that these girls will have open hearts to receive God’s Word.
